Alkaloids are basic nitrogen-containing compounds of plant origin, many of which are physiologically active when administered to humans. Ingestion of coniine, isolated from water hemlock, can cause weakness, labored respiration, paralysis, and eventually death. Coniine is the toxic substance in the “poison hemlock” used in the death of Socrates. In small doses, nicotine is an addictive stimulant. In larger doses, it causes depression, nausea, and vomiting. In still larger doses, it is a deadly poison. Solutions of nicotine in water are used as insecticides. Cocaine is a central nervous system stimulant obtained from the leaves of the coca plant.Classify each amino group in these alkaloids according to type (primary, secondary, tertiary, aliphatic, aromatic, heterocyclic).
Carboxylic acids are acidic enough to dissolve in both 10% NaOH and NaHCO3. Phenols, ArOH, are weak acids and most phenols will not dissolve in 10% NaHCO3. How would you separate a mixture of a carboxylic acid (RCOOH), an amine (RNH2), a phenol (ArOH) and a hydrocarbon (RH) using chemically active extraction? Draw a flow chart to illustrate your separation. Show each species in the aqueous and organic layers.
